About the Mountain Velvetbreast
The Mountain Velvetbreast (Lafresnaya lafresnayi) is a species of bird in the Hummingbirds family (Trochilidae), within the order Apodiformes. This family contains 363 recognized species worldwide.
Use the eBird species code mouvel1 when logging sightings in eBird or other citizen science platforms.
